Differentiate between an Enacted Constitution and an Evolved Constitution.

Basis Enacted Constitution Evolved Constitution
Meaning A constitution that is deliberately created and written by a constituent assembly. A constitution that develops gradually over time through customs, traditions, and judicial decisions.
Form It is written and codified in a single document or organized set of documents. It is mostly uncodified, relying on statutes, conventions, and legal precedents not contained in a single document.
Time of Origin Has a definite date of adoption and is created at a specific point in time. Evolves over centuries and has no specific date of origin.
Example India and the USA have enacted constitutions with a formal adoption process. The United Kingdom (UK) has an evolved constitution based on practices and laws developed over time.
Clarity and Structure Clear, systematic, and legally organized, with well-defined provisions. Less clear; depends on interpretation and political practices, often evolving with changing circumstances.
